It also "rev holds" on upshifts using sport mode.
We ran a loose experiment at our local track with a GT4. Using sport mode it gave away 0.4-0.5s a lap to my GT3 due to 3 upshifts per 1.4 mile lap. My 993 gives away 1.2s on 6 upshifts same lap (Lower gearing). It's a relatively tight track. Turning sport mode off the same driver in the GT4 will loose another 0.3-0.4s a lap, not so much from the auto blip downshifts although they aid stability much like PDK but in the rev hold on upshifts!
The secret to the manual GT4 lap times on track is twofold. Tall gearing for less upshifts with similar torque to 911/GT3 but also the BIG factor is rev hold on upshifts.
In sport mode the GT4 is acting more like a PDK than a true manual.
If you want to try this yourself ask a mate at the track who times his laps and is competent and consistent to turn sport mode off and see what it does to his lap times. I 100% guaranty they will be slower. No matter how good he is at heel and tie he cannot emulate the "rev hold" benefits on up shift.....
This is one reason why the delta on track between GT4 and GT3 is relatively small. The rest is down to the GT4 superior dynamics and slightly lower weight.
Many wax lyrical about GT4 manual transmission being so involving. But they only use sport mode especially in the track. Having driven all of them my opinion is an air cooled manual is a vastly different MT experience. It's slower, move involving and it doesn't help you. Of course this can work against a poor MT driver who doesn't know how to H&T...

Most people dont know its there. On the track is where its much more apparent (i.e. shifting at peak rpm under load on a straight). A track buddy with a GT4 didnt believe me either till he switched it off.
Under load on maximum throttle when you up-shift with a traditional manual the revs will drop off very quickly. No matte how fast you physically shift the engine will loos a few thousand revs before you engage the clutch on the next gear. The function built into the sport mode holds those revs for approximately 2s till you select the next gear and pull the clutch out. It makes a difference to the data traces - you can see and feel the effect immediately...

Sport mode in GT cars is Rev-matching and only Rev-matching. There is no other function with Sport button. Sport Exhaust and Sport Suspension have separate buttons. In non-GT cars, you get sportier throttle and PSM with Sport. This is not true in GT cars - PSM has two separate buttons for dual stages of deactivation and the throttle is always in sportiest setting.

The reason you cannot turn TC off while leaving ESC on is because when traction control is disabled it allows for wheelspin and wheelspin causes yaw angles and yaw angles are prevented by ESC. It makes perfect logical sense if you think about it (ESC would act like TC anyways).
The GT4 has as many independent buttons as one could ever want or need (some would say too many). I assure you it's not an issue when driving (you have as many options as you will need - use Sport or don't, use Firm or Soft Suspension, use Sport Exhaust or not, drive with PSM on, or just TC on, or PSM totally off).
